Objections to Provisional Answer Key Reviewed
Students had a specific time frame to raise objections against the provisional answer key for **AILET 2026**. During this period, if a student believed an answer was incorrect, they could submit their challenge along with a fee. NLU Delhi will now check each of these challenges. If a student's objection is found to be correct, the fee they paid for that specific objection will be returned to them. It is important to know that NLU Delhi will not accept any new challenges or requests to change the answer key after the set deadline. Once the final answer key is released, no further objections will be allowed.
What is the AILET Exam?
For students considering a career in law, AILET is a very important national-level entrance examination. It is conducted by NLU Delhi for admission to its undergraduate (BA LLB Hons) and postgraduate (LLM) law programs. Thousands of students from all over India take this exam each year to secure a seat in one of the country's top law universities. The answer key helps students estimate their scores before the official results are declared.

How to Download the Final Answer Key
Once the final answer key is ready, students can easily download it from the NLU Delhi official website. Here are the steps to follow:
- Visit the official website: **nationallawuniversitydelhi.in**.
- Scroll down the homepage to find the "Notifications" section.
- Look for and click on the link that says "**AILET 2026 Answer Key**".
- The final answer key will open as a PDF document on your screen.
- Click on the download button to save the PDF file to your computer or phone.
- You can then check your answers against the official key to get an idea of your performance.

Counselling Process for Admissions
Successfully qualifying in the AILET 2026 exam and having a valid scorecard are the first steps towards admission. The next stage is the counselling process. In counselling, eligible students will register and participate to secure their admission into the BA LLB (Hons) or LLM programs at NLU Delhi. The university will release a detailed schedule and guidelines for the counselling rounds soon after the results are declared. Students must follow these instructions carefully to complete their admission process.
